Hello.. My baby is 2 years and 1 month old. His weight is only 10 kg. I give him all possible things to eat like oats, dalia, raagi, dry fruits, rice, vegetables, chapattis etc. But why his weight is not gaining. Other than this he is full active baby, he play well sleep well. But my concerns is his weight is not gaining. What to do ?

1 Answer
ExpertDr. Minal AcharyaNutritionist3 years ago
A. dear mum, weight of 10 kg is a normal weight for 2 years 1 month old baby, do not worry. some babies gain weight slowly. if baby is active, playful and achieving all growth milestones then it indicates good health. A 2 years old child should be given all the foods that are prepared in the house give five meals this includes two healthy snacks give more than One Katori every time the meals should be wholesome having variety of food groups like grains, pulses/non veg vegetables green leafy vegetables fruits dairy products like curd paneer nuts control intake of high sugar, oil and salt containing food and beverages, processed and packaged foods
